Witryna8 gru 2015 · Reason ( al-‘aql ), the God-given ability to acquire knowledge and recognize truth, has been assigned an exalted status in Islam. Rational thought and the resultant disciplines of logical thinking and scientific inquiry are essential for understanding the divine revelation and its relationship to the natural world.
